Vital SeedSpell 4
Source Pathfinder Impossible Magic
Traditions Divine, Occult
Cast

Range 120 feet
Target 1 creature
You launch a seed that drains the life energy of nearby creatures. Make a ranged spell attack to embed a seed of energy into your target. If the target is willing, you automatically succeed. A successful attack embeds the seed, causing it to drain essence out of nearby creatures, dealing 2d12 void damage with a basic Fortitude save to all other creatures in a 15-foot emanation from the target.
The seed then erupts with vital energyโif the initial target is living, they recover Hit Points equal to twice the damage a single creature took from this spell; calculate these Hit Points using the creature that took the most damage. If the initial target is undead, it instead takes vitality damage equal to the amount a living creature would've healed.
Heightened (+2) The seed's void damage increases by 1d12.

AttackAn ability with this trait involves an attack. For each attack you make beyond the first on your turn, you take a multiple attack penalty.
ConcentrateAn action with this trait requires a degree of mental concentration and discipline.
ManipulateYou must physically manipulate an item or make gestures to use an action with this trait. Creatures without a suitable appendage can't perform actions with this trait. Manipulate actions often trigger reactions.
VitalityEffects with this trait heal living creatures with energy from the Forge of Creation, deal vitality energy damage to undead, or manipulate vitality energy.
VoidEffects with this trait heal undead creatures with void energy, deal void damage to living creatures, or manipulate void energy.
